Bahamas Bound 2001-2002
Page 1

This Adventure begins in the Chesapeake Bay during the late Fall, 2001.  We left Rock Hall, Maryland as the cold air began settling in for the winter.  We were ready to go after being chained to a marina for six weeks for lightening repairs.
